Top 5 Third Person Games on Android in Oman: Q1 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top third-person games on Android in Oman during Q1 2025, with insights on downloads, revenue, and active users from Sensor Tower.
In the first quarter of 2025, third-person games on the Android platform in Oman showed varied performance trends. According to data from Sensor Tower, here’s a detailed look at the top five games in this category.
Free Fire x NARUTO SHIPPUDEN experienced a notable increase in its we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$15.3K in the last week of March. Downloads showed an upward trend mid-quarter, reaching around 7.6K in late February, while weekly active users saw a rise from 114.4K to 148.3K by the end of the quarter.
Subway Surfers maintained relatively stable weekly downloads, with a peak of 5.9K in February. Revenue was modest but saw a slight increase, reaching $116 in late March. Active users rose significantly towards the end of the quarter, from 67.8K to 85.5K.
456 Run Challenge: Clash 3D showed varied download trends, spiking to 9.8K in February. Active users increased from 9.9K at the start of the quarter to 12.2K by the end, despite no revenue being recorded.
PUBG MOBILE saw a significant boost in weekly revenue, reaching $17.1K in late March. Downloads remained steady, peaking at 4.1K in early March, while weekly active users fluctuated, ending the quarter at 39.2K.
Ultimate Traffic Driving Car experienced a notable increase in active users, peaking at 7.2K in early March, although downloads decreased towards the end of the quarter. Revenue was minimal, with a peak of $18 at the beginning of the quarter.
